Welcome to History's Not Boring! Get ready for a story that is
genuinely terrifying and totally fascinating: The Great Fire of
London! Picture this: It's 1666, and London is a massive city,
packed tight with about 80,000 people. But here's the scary
part—most of the buildings were made of wood, squished together
on narrow streets. That’s a disaster waiting to happen!

It all started innocently enough in a tiny bakery on Pudding
Lane. But soon, flames jumped from roof to roof! We’ll talk about
how this one small spark grew into a monster fire that destroyed
most of the city. Why did the fire burn for four long days? How
did they finally stop it? And what weird objects did people try
to save from the blaze?
